This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 21907. [AN ITEM DESIGNED TO ACCELERATE A GAS TURBINE ENGINE FROM REST TO STARTER CUTOFF SPEED BY MEANS OF A COMBUSTION GAS DRIVEN TURBINE AND REDUCTION GEAR ASSEMBLY CONSTRUCTED TO BE MOUNTED ON THE ENGINE STARTER DRIVE. THE COMBUSTION GAS IS GENERATED FROM IGNITED LIQUID FUEL AND AIR IN THE COMBUSTION CHAMBER OR FROM A SOLID PROPELLANT CARTRIDGE ATTACHED TO THE COMBUSTION CHAMBER OF THE STARTER. MAY HAVE PROVISION FOR ENERGIZING THE TURBINE BY LOW PRESSURE AIR FROM ENGINE BLEED OR GROUND EQUIPMENT AIR SUPPLY.].
